Back Up App Data:

  1. Open “Settings”
  2. Go to “Cloud and accounts”
  3. Tap “Backup & Restore”
  4. Enable “Back up my data” to back up app data, settings, and Wi-Fi passwords to your backup account
  5. Enable “Automatic Restore” to allow app data, settings, and passwords to be restored automatically the next time you log in with the backup account or when reinstalling apps

Back Up Contacts:

  1. Launch “Contacts”
  2. Access “Cloud and accounts”
  3. Go to “Accounts”
  4. Select an account type and the account you want to use for syncing the contacts
  5. Make sure the “Contacts” check box is ticked
  6. When ready, tap “Menu” > “Sync Now”

Back Up Contacts to SD or Internal Storage:

  1. Launch “Settings”
  2. Go to “Applications”
  3. Tap “Contacts”
  4. Select to “Import/Export” contacts
  5. Tap “Export” and select “Storage” or “SD Card”
  6. Tap “OK” to confirm

Back Up Media Files to SD Storage:

  1. Launch “My Files”
  2. Go to “Local storage”
  3. Tap “Device storage” > “More”
  4. Tap “Edit” and select the media files you want to back up
  5. Tap “More” > “Copy” > “SD card”
  6. Select the desired folder or tap “Create folder”
  7. When ready tap “Paste here”

Back Up Media Files on a Windows PC:

  1. Connect the Android device to the computer via USB
  2. On the phone, enable “Media device” / “File Transfer” at the prompt or from the Notification area
  3. Open the File Explorer on the computer
  4. Locate the media files on the phone
  5. Copy and transfer the files to the desired backup location on the PC storage
  6. Once done, eject the phone storage and safely disconnect the device from the USB port

Back Up Media Files on a Mac Computer:

NOTE: If Samsung Kies is installed on the Mac, skip the first 3 steps below.

  1. Launch the Internet browser on the Mac
  2. Visit https://www.samsung.com/us/support/owners/app/kies
  3. Click “Download for Mac” and install the app on the Mac
  4. Then, connect the phone to the Mac via USB
  5. On the phone, enable “File Transfer” / “Media device” at the prompt or from the Notification shade
  6. Launch Kies on the Mac
  7. In Kies, go to the “Backup” section
  8. Tick the boxes associated with “Photos” “Music” and other media file types you want to back up
  9. Click “Backup” to begin the sync
  10. Once done, drag the phone’s virtual drive from the desktop and drop it over the trash can to eject it
  11. Safely disconnect the device from the USB port
